How to fill out consent for soft tissue

01
Begin by clearly explaining the purpose of the soft tissue procedure to the patient.
02
Provide the patient with all relevant information about the risks, benefits, and alternatives to the procedure.
03
Ensure that the patient fully understands the information provided and is able to make an informed decision.
04
Have the patient sign the consent form, indicating their agreement to undergo the soft tissue procedure.
05
Make a copy of the signed consent form for the patient's records and keep the original on file.
